Hey, new folks — welcome to team Lexigrove! This page covers break-glass access for stringscoop, our translation-string extraction script. Normally you'll never touch this: the script runs nightly and pushes strings to the Polyglot queue on its own. But if extraction jams right before a release and on-call is unreachable, you're allowed to run it manually in emergency mode. Audit logs capture everything, so don't panic. The emergency runner will prompt for the passphrase below.

vault phrase of kawep-tahog = ulaix-briath

Canary gating in Driftgate works as follows: a deploy advances only when error rate, p95 latency, and saturation all stay under baseline for two consecutive evaluation windows; a single breach pauses promotion, and two breaches trigger automatic rollback. Gating rules are declared per service in the manifest and evaluated by the Driftgate controller, not the CI runner. For this week's sync demo, the controller authenticates to the metrics backend using the internal key provided below.

API key for yahig-tadup: kto7_ubizbYm

## Sensor drift: what to do at 3am

If the GrowLoop controller starts reporting humidity swings that don't match the backup probes in the Fernwick greenhouse, it's almost always sensor drift, not an actual climate event. Don't panic and don't touch the vents manually. First, restart the calibration daemon and give it ten minutes to re-baseline. If readings still disagree by more than 5%, flip the controller into safe mode. The safe-mode thresholds it will use are these.

config for yahap-bajof:
[istix]
host = istix.qorvelsys.internal
user = istix_svc
database = istix_prod

Alert: SproutCycle's watering scheduler skipped the 06:00 run for all greenhouse zones after the cron migration in release 4.2. The fallback timer fired twice instead, double-watering bed clusters in the Fernlow test site. The regression traces to the refactored interval parser in the scheduler module. Review the diff against the previous parser before approving the hotfix. Full incident timeline is on the internal page below.

dashboard of tahop-fahof = https://harbor.tolvaqnet.example/secrets/merge_requests/board/issue/merge_requests/pipeline/secrets/ecb30ed86a55c001a77f6cb9